How does the drug interact with Mefly 250mg Tablet:
Taking Mefly 250mg Tablet with Ziprasidone can increase the risk of irregular heart rhythm.
How to manage the interaction:
Taking Mefly 250mg Tablet with Ziprasidone is not recommended, but it can be taken together if prescribed by a doctor. However, consult your doctor if you experience sudden dizziness, lightheadedness, fainting, shortness of breath. Do not discontinue any medications without consulting a doctor.

How does the drug interact with Mefly 250mg Tablet:
Coadministration of Mefly 250mg Tablet and ketoconazole can increase the blood levels and can result in a possibly harmful heart rhythm irregularity.
How to manage the interaction:
Although taking Ketoconazole and Mefly 250mg Tablet together can result in an interaction, it can be taken if a doctor has prescribed it. However, if you have sudden dizziness, lightheadedness, fainting, or fast or pounding heartbeats, you should consult a doctor immediately. Ketoconazole should not be taken with Mefly 250mg Tablet or within 15 weeks of your last dose of Mefly 250mg Tablet. Do not stop using any medications without a doctor's advice.
